Sannasgala and Chathuranga were released on bail for denigrating Buddhism

0

According to a court order regarding the scripting and publication of a book denigrating Buddhism under the name ‘Budunge Rastiyaduwa’, Upul Shantha Sannasgala and Srinath Chathurangaappeared in court today and were released on Rs. 50,000 bails each by Colombo Chief Magistrate Nandana Amarasinghe today.

The court ordered the two to appear before the court on April 29.

The magistrate also directed the police to seek the advice of the Attorney General regarding this book and issue a court order in this regard.

According to a complaint lodged by Dr. Wijayadasa Rajapaksa on August 20, 2018, when he was the Minister of Higher Education and Cultural Affairs, the police had conducted an investigation and informed the court.
